By donating an item or service to our 2011 Spring Conference Silent Auction, you will benefit from exposure of your company's name to the 200+ business professionals who will attend the state's premiere social responsibility event of the year.

 

Ideal items include gift certificates, gift baskets, books, artwork and professional services. Donors will be listed in the conference materials, and all donated merchandise will be showcased at the conference. You are welcome to display business cards and brochures along with your item.

 

Please consider donating an item to support the continued work of NHBSR. In addition to getting your name out there, you will be making a tax-deductible contribution that will help NHBSR continue to offer valuable programs and services that help support the growing community of socially-minded NH businesses.   

 

The deadline for donating a silent auction item is Friday, April 29th.

"Why Build Green? You Do the Math!"

Register   

Tom Sullivan 

Tom Sullivan, President, Sullivan Construction, Inc.

 

The change in construction projects is coming fast with "building green and living green in commercial buildings." In this webinar learn about the premium for constructing and planning a green sustainable project. You'll also learn about energy partnering, payback, annual savings and the long-term benefits to the environment and the employees. The alternative is astonishing and now is not the time to procrastinate; it's our global living place. You'll come away from this webinar knowing who to reach out to in construction pre-plan, planning and construction, administering to LEED standards in construction, whether or not there is a difference between LEED and green and the benefits of sustainability, commitment and feeling good about what you do everyday!
